Episode 40: Agriculture

An episode of the Distillations | Science History Institute podcast, hosted by Science History Institute, titled "Episode 40: Agriculture" was published on September 12, 2008 and runs 11 minutes.

All over the Midwest, farmers are cranking up their combines for the corn harvest. Modern agriculture depends on science and technology at every step of the way, from genetically modified crops, to the fertilizer on the fields, to the fuel in the tractor.

SHOW CLOCK

00:00 Opening Credits

00:21 Introduction

01:21 Element of the Week: Nitrogen

03:27 Feature: Biodiesel and glycerine

08:06 Mystery Solved! Compost

10:43 Quote: Walt Whitman

11:16 Closing Credits
